The Fluke Model 2100A is a digital, thermocouple thermometer, employing the dual-slope integration technique, and capable of making precise temperature measurements in either degrees Fahrenheit (°F) or degrees Celsius (°C). The instrument is fully guarded and features a fully isolated input. 1-3. The 2100A has a five-digit readout (plus sign) capable of indicating up to ±3999.9 degrees. However, the range of the instrument is determined by the type of thermocouple used. The instrument can be ordered, configured to use any of the following types: J, K, T, E, R and S. Table 1-1 shows the temperature ranges for each of these types. Resolution of the instrument is 0.1 degree, except in instruments using a type R or a type S thermocouple and indicating in °F, when resolution is 0.2 degrees. The readout features 0.5 inch characters, fixed decimal point, and leading-zero suppression for the two most significant digits. 1-4. The 2100A is available in three basic models: the 2100A—03, the 2100A-06, and the 2100A-10. The 2100A--03 is a single-point instrument (one input); the 2100A-10 is a multi-point instrument (10 inputs). Both of these models are tailored at the factory to use only one specific type of thermocouple. Once tailored, the 2100A— 03 and 2100A—10 are limited to that one type, but can be converted to any one of the other five at any time, by means of a conversion kit. 1-5. The 2100A—06 is a multi-type instrument. It is tailored to accept inputs from any of the six different types of thermocouple, but only one type at any given time. (The 2100A—06 is not a multi-point instrument). In effect, the 2100A—06 is a 2100A—03 that can be rapidly converted to accept different thermocouples, by means of integral selector switches, rather than conversion kits. For valid indications from a 2100A—06, the selector switch depressed must correspond to the type of thermocouple being used. In addition, the 2100A—06 can accept linearized voltage inputs on either of two selectable mV ranges directly from other transducers, such as bridge-connected strain gauges.
